楚霸王困垓下 chǔ​bà​wáng​kùn​gāi​xià
to be cornered from all sides
(xiehouyu) trapped like the Hegemon King of Chu at Gaixia; describes a situation where one is isolated and under attack from all directions; the first half of a two-part allegory whose second half is 四面楚歌 sì​miàn​chǔ​gē
